Parmesan Crusted Cod Fish Fillets by Gorton's carries a composite safety score of 100/100, which we classify as "Safe" on our four-tier shelf-label framework. The score is computed by mapping each labeled ingredient against FDA Substances Added to Food (SAFFA) regulatory status and CSPI Chemical Cuisine classifications, then penalizing the overall product for each additive rated as caution-or-worse. Product data originates from the OpenFoodFacts collaborative catalog; safety annotations come from federal regulators and the Center for Science in the Public Interest.

Our scan did not identify any ingredients in this product that FDA SAFFA or CSPI Chemical Cuisine data flags as requiring caution or avoidance at the time of analysis. That is a meaningful clean-label signal, though it does not account for personal allergens, regional recalls, or inspection findings not reflected in federal additive databases. The per-ingredient breakdown below shows the source-level classification for each component.

On the NOVA processing scale, Parmesan Crusted Cod Fish Fillets is classified as Group 4 (Ultra-processed). NOVA measures industrial processing intensity rather than ingredient-level safety, so it complements the SAFFA and CSPI ratings: a product can be clean on additive flags but heavily processed, or lightly processed but carry individually flagged ingredients. Combining both lenses gives a fuller picture than either alone. The Nutri-Score grade of B reflects nutritional balance — calories, saturated fat, sugar, sodium versus fiber, protein, and produce content — which again is a distinct dimension from additive safety and worth weighing alongside the scores above.

Full Ingredient List

COD, ENRICHED BLEACHED WHEAT FLOUR (FLOUR, NIACIN, IRON, THIAMIN MONONITRATE, RIBOFLAVIN, FOLIC ACID), WATER, VEGETABLE OIL (COTTONSEED AND/OR CANOLA), LESS THAN 2% OF: YELLOW CORN FLOUR, PARMESAN, CHEDDAR, BLUE, ROMANO CHEESE AND ENZYME MODIFIED CHEDDAR AND PARMESAN CHEESE (MILK, CULTURE, SALT, ENZYMES), MODIFIED CORN STARCH, SUGAR, SALT, SPICES, WHEY, MALTODEXTRIN, YEAST, WHEAT FLOUR, BAKING POWDER (BAKING SODA, SODIUM ALUMINIUM PHOSPHATE), CORN OIL, PARSLEY, BLACK PEPPER NATURAL FLAVOR, CORN SYRUP SOLIDS, DEXTROSE, CITRIC ACID, SODIUM CASEINATE, COLORED WITH PAPRIKA, ANNATTO, AND TURMERIC EXTRACTS, CREAM, MALIC ACID, LEMON JUICE SOLIDS, LACTIC ACID, SODIUM TRIPOLYPHOSPHATE (TO RETAIN FISH MOISTURE).
